Aging doesn’t mean slowing down—it’s an opportunity to embrace fitness for better health, mobility, and energy. Regular exercise for elderly people can significantly improve quality of life, reduce the risk of chronic conditions, and enhance longevity. Whether you’re looking for exercise routines for over 60’s, or starting fitness after 40, it’s never too late to begin. With activities like walking, swimming, and resistance training, older adults can build strength, boost cardiovascular health, and maintain flexibility.
